Stuffed Green Peppers
5-6 medium green peppers
3/4 cup uncooked brown rice (can use white)
1 pound lean ground beef
1 medium onion, chopped
1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ce
1/4 teaspoon dried basil
1/4 teaspoon dried oregano
1/4 teaspoon dried thyme
1/2 teaspoon salt
pepper to taste
1/2 teaspoon beef bouillon
1-2 cups shredded cheese (whatever kind you like)
Remove tops from the peppers . Remove the seeds and discard. In a large kettle, bring water to a boil. Cook peppers for 5 minutes. Remove from kettle and drain. Cook rice according to package directions. In a skillet, brown beef and onions. Drain any fat. Add tomato sauce, basil, oregano, thyme, salt, pepper and beef bouillon; cook for 5 minutes. Stir in rice. Add half of your cheese to the mixture. Stuff peppers with the rice mixture. Sprinkle remaining cheese on top of peppers. Place upright in a shallow baking dish or casserole. Bake at 375° for 15-20 minutes. Yield: 5-6 servings.
